Getting Your Roof Ready for Winter

As winter approaches, it’s essential to prepare your roof to withstand the colder months and avoid costly repairs.

Here’s a checklist to ensure your roof is ready:

  • Inspect for Damage: Check for missing or damaged shingles, cracks, and signs of wear. Repairing these early prevents leaks and further damage when snow accumulates.
  • Clean Your Gutters: Clear gutters and downspouts of leaves and debris to avoid water buildup and ice dams that can cause damage.

  • Check Attic Insulation and Ventilation: Proper attic insulation keeps your home warm and prevents ice dams from forming on your roof. Ensure vents are free of blockages to maintain good airflow.
  • Trim Overhanging Branches: Heavy snow can cause branches to break and damage your roof. Trim any overhanging trees to minimize risk.

  • Install Ice and Water Shields: Consider adding ice and water shields along the eaves to protect against water infiltration and ice dams.
  • Examine Flashing: Inspect fl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ights for any gaps or damage. Secure or replace flashing to keep water out.
  • Schedule a Professional Roof Inspection: If you’re unsure about the condition of your roof, schedule a professional inspection. A roofing expert can spot issues that may not be visible from the ground.
